Senior Financial Analyst (Temporary)
Atlantic Group is seeking a Temporary Senior Financial Analyst to support the Houston business with hands-on revenue and financial analysis. This highly operational role focuses on revenue forecasting, billing accuracy, and financial reporting, requiring strong Excel skills and experience with ERP/finance systems.

Responsibilities
Perform financial analysis including forecasting, budgeting, and variance analysis
Compile and analyze weekly and monthly Houston revenue and billing data
Lead the revenue forecasting process and monitor revenue completeness and accuracy
Partner with billing and operations teams to validate billing data and supporting documentation
Develop financial models, KPIs, dashboards, and management reports
Support budget preparation and identify cost optimization opportunities
Document and stabilize revenue-related processes; identify automation improvements over time
Present financial insights to management and cross-functional stakeholders
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Finance or Accounting
5+ years of experience in financial analysis or accounting
Advanced Excel skills; strong data analysis and reporting experience
Experience with ERP systems; Microsoft Dynamics Business Central (or similar) strongly preferred
Solid understanding of GAAP
Strong commun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ills
Preferred
Experience in logistics, terminal, or port operations is a plus
